The Taiwan Times Village (Chinese: 寶島時代村; pinyin: Bǎodǎo Shídài Cūn) is a museum in Caotun Township, Nantou County, Taiwan.[1]

Exhibitions

The museums exhibits the past life of Taiwan, which includes the life of Hakka, Hoklo, Taiwanese aborigines and veterans from Mainland China in different community blocks.

Transportation

The museum is accessible from Highway 3.
